Why these movies?
The story pattern: Stories in this thread typically unfold through a series of sessions or conversations, where a professional helper guides the protagonist through fragmented memories. The central conflict is internal, as the character battles their own psyche to piece together a horrifying past. The climax is often the full recollection and acceptance of the trauma, leading to a sense of wholeness and hope.
Why they belong together: Movies are grouped here based on their shared focus on psychotherapy as a narrative engine, a heavy emotional weight derived from confronting abuse, and a journey that moves from profound darkness to a hopeful, earned resolution.
